Output 6c72f232c20ac28e8873d84bc8e076aa8d0b4b2abbb6d064623dce7ef160e462:0

value
30780361329
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c939b04f68db04aa721bfee2ee7aa15838a74b OP_EQUALVERIFY OP_CHECKSIG
address
1L8FHUY3PaQvUQxyKHgPcJKTKL4GbqUsVQ
transaction
6c72f232c20ac28e8873d84bc8e076aa8d0b4b2abbb6d064623dce7ef160e462
spent
true